Raisin and Nut Oat Loaf: Date Added: 10 Jun 2009
Listed in: Breads (Yeast)
Ingredients

1 pint scalded milk
1 cup rolled oats
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up molasses or sugar
1 yeast cake
1/2 cup lukewarm water
2 cups whole wheat flour
1 cup raisins
1 cup chopped nut meats

Cooking Instructions

Pour the scalded milk over the oats and cook slowly to a mush, adding salt, molasses or sugar. When lukewarm add the yeast, which has been softened in the water, add flour, chopped raisins, and nut meats. Knead carefully on a well-floured board until it loses its stickiness. Form into two loaves, place in well-greased pan and let stand until very light. Brush over with milk or egg and bake in a moderately hot oven. Time in oven, 1 hour and 20 minutes. Temperature, 380°.
